The Latter Rain: Origins and Developments presents a simplified historical map of the religious movements, ministries, and organizations connected to or influenced by the Latter Rain Movement. It traces earlier roots through British Israelism, Christian Science, the Higher Life/Keswick tradition, John Alexander Dowie, Charles Parham, and the Christian and Missionary Alliance, then shows their influence on Pentecostalism and major Pentecostal denominations. From there, the chart places the Latter Rain Movement alongside the postwar Healing Revival and maps its later connections to Full Gospel Business Men’s Fellowship, William Branham’s Message movement, Voice of Healing, Word of Faith, prosperity teaching, the Shepherding Movement, Christian Identity groups, People’s Temple, Calvary Chapel, Vineyard, Bethel, and other charismatic, restorationist, and sectarian movements. The chart is not presented as a complete history, but as an overview of overlapping networks and lines of influence surrounding Latter Rain theology, Pentecostal revivalism, healing evangelism, and later apostolic-prophetic movements.
